perl-POE-Component-Client-DNS


Information about the package, perl-POE-Component-Client-DNS, which is shipped with common Linux distributions. The perl-POE-Component-Client-DNS package is designed for, Non-blocking/concurrent DNS queries using Net::DNS and POE.


Package Name:

perl-POE-Component-Client-DNS

Summary:

Non-blocking/concurrent DNS queries using Net::DNS and POE

Description:

POE::Component::Client::DNS provides a facility for non-blocking, concurrent DNS requests. Using POE, it allows other tasks to run while waiting for name servers to respond.
